1. Unpack the cards and remove any
shipping materials. The
PostScript card is marked PS on
the label. The memory card is
marked 16MB on the label.
2. Turn off the printer, and remove
the power cord and interface
cable.
NOTE: If you have a network card
installed, remove it temporarily before
installing the PostScript option.
3. Loosen the access panel screw.
4. Remove the access panel and locate
the PostScript connector (1).
5. Install the PostScript card:
a. Hold the card (make sure PS is
on the label) so that the notch
(2) is on the bottom right
corner.

b. Position the card into the
connector.
c. Press down on the card until it
snaps into place and the gold
contacts are fully inserted in
the connector.
6. Install the memory chip:
Insert the card with the notch
towards the front of the printer.
Press down on the card until it
snaps into place and the gold
contacts are fully inserted in the
connector.

7. Check to make sure that both
cards are fully inserted and
installed correctly.
8. Replace the access panel:
a. Align the panel tabs at bottom.
b. Swing the panel up and in place.
c. Tighten the screw.
9. Verify Installation
Print a Menu Map:
a. Press the Menu button one or
more times until INFO.MENU
appears on the display.
b. Press SELECT twice. The
MenuMap prints.
c. PSE Program version and Total
Memory Size 32 MB appears
in the header, and PRINT PSE
FONT in the Information
Menu. If not, check to be sure
that the cards are installed
correctly.
Your printer is factory set to AUTO
EMULATION (AUTO appears on
the printer display). In this setting
the printer will sample data and
automatically switch between
PostScript emulation and the other
emulations. If the printer is not set to
AUTO EMULATION, see the
User's Guide for instructions to set
it in the printer Menu.
